An electric cell has two terminals; one is called positive (+ ve) while the other is negative (– ve). An electric bulb hasa filament that is connected to itsterminals. An electric bulb glows when electric current passes through it.

Bulb have two terminals, because an electrical circuit is a closed loop & current has to flow through things to make them work.
